The Effect of Shade on Feelings
Frequently, the colors we border ourselves with can significantly affect our mood and overall well-being. The impact of color on feelings is a well-researched field within psychology and interior decoration.
Cozy shades like red, orange, and yellow are recognized to evoke feelings of power, warmth, and convenience. These tones can boost conversation and develop a comfortable ambiance in an area.
In contrast, cool shades such as blue, green, and purple have a tendency to have a calming effect, promoting relaxation and serenity. These shades are frequently liked in bedrooms and workplaces to create a sense of calmness.
Furthermore, the intensity and saturation of colors play a critical role in identifying their emotional effect. Brilliant, vibrant shades can elicit feelings of excitement and enthusiasm, while low-key tones are more relaxing and gentle.

Choosing the Right Paint Colors
Comprehending the psychology of color and its effect on feelings can lead people in choosing the appropriate paint shades for their living spaces. When choosing paint shades, it's important to consider the mood you want to develop in each space.
For example, soothing shades like blue and eco-friendly are ideal for bed rooms and leisure areas, as they promote a sense of harmony. On the other hand, vivid tones like yellow or red can stimulate and promote conversation in social spaces such as living rooms or eating areas.
Along with the psychological effect, the size and lighting of a room must likewise influence color options. Lighter shades can make a little space feel even more roomy, while darker tones can add heat and coziness to bigger areas. Natural light improves the means shades show up, so it's crucial to examine paint examples in various lights problems before making a decision.
Inevitably, choosing the right paint shades entails a thoughtful consideration of both emotional feedbacks and useful aspects to produce a harmonious and comfy living atmosphere.
